About Alamosa County

Alamosa is the home rule city that is the county seat of, and the most populous municipality in, Alamosa County, Colorado United States. Alamosa is located along the Rio Grande. The city population was 9,806 in the 2020 United States census. The city is the commercial center of the San Luis Valley in south-central Colorado, and is the home of Adams State University. Alamosa is the primary city of the Alamosa, CO Micropolitan Statistical Area.

Swung Right in 2024

Alamosa County shifted 10.1 points toward Republicans compared to 2020. Voter turnout decreased by 3.7%.
